The Neighbourhood Training and Resource Centre works in partnership with the consultant Josephine Yates to deliver this 4 day course. The course has been devised especially for those who need particular skills to establish good inter-personal relations and the ability to avoid or minimise the occurrence of potentially difficult or dangerous situations. It is very important to work effectively at all times, but particularly when working with people who are in potentially hostile or dangerous situations, or who are vulnerable.

8th Annual Regional Warden Conference for Yorkshire & The Humber (March 2010)
This conference was the 8th Annual Regional Warden Conference to be organised and facilitated by the Neighbourhood Training and Resource Centre. The aim of the day was to share best practice and knowledge, with key speakers and workshop facilitators from across the region. The Conference provides the opportunity for Community Wardens within Yorkshire & Humber to take away information, new contacts and hopefully helpful ideas that can assist warden schemes in providing best practice and continued partnership working.
